Output 5f66876b36abc7d94bd4f56b358daa504a900ebed36238200ddc491d8741831c:0
- value
- 21400218
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8bd40f41244caa040a23e5e05deb9edc9ebdb60 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NDcV5sPcv31m875RhZ7VXiQaXWvwHHCwg
- transaction
- 5f66876b36abc7d94bd4f56b358daa504a900ebed36238200ddc491d8741831c
- confirmations
- 540880
- spent
- true